Sup guys,

I've been looking through the boards and saw that most people have their letters of rec from science professors. My 2 letters of rec right now are from an Af-Am teacher and the Director of Campus Organizations. I have a third one on the way from my research professor, but won't have it til the beginning of September. Is this going to be a problem?

Also a lot of people were talking about getting their letters from committees. How do you get one of these letters?
 
If your school doesn't have a committee, you don't need to send one in.

Schools usually require 2 science profs + 1 non-science prof as requirements.
 
those letters won't be sufficient for a lot of schools. you need to get 2 science letters (they should both be from someone who you took a class with and got graded and one at least should be from your major) and a non-science letter. everything else is considered just extra. if you follow this guideline, you should be able to meet the LOR requirements for the vast majority of schools.
